21 Progres in Africa.. 3 COUNTRIES South Africa Burkina Faso Sudan 3 CROPS Maize Cotton Soybean 3.3 MILLIONS HECTARES

22 Progres in Africa Commercial Countries Nothing in ECA

23 Principal GM Crops In Africa Soybean Cotton Maize

24 Farmer testimonies Burkina Faso farmers: Advantages of Bt cotton: 1. Labour is less tedious (2 sprays instead of 8) 2. Better health 3. Increased yield 4. More income: Bought farm equipment, built new houses,new motorbikes and own businesses etc. 5. Enabled to take children to school and take care of families

25 Burkina Faso Farmers Mr. Tasséré Ilboudo, Bazèga province Bt cotton farmer for more than 4 years Mrs Azèta Kinda, Binsboumbou village, Bazèga Province, Bt cotton province for more than 4 years Mr. Coulibaly Tankelé, Dissankuy village, Solenzo province, Bt cotton farmer > 4 years

26 Sudan farmers Increase from 2013: ~46% with 90,000 ha of Bt cotton

27 Progres in Africa Pipeline GM Crops Source: Clive James, 2014 RSA maize, potatoes, sugarcane, Cameroon: cotton Kenya cassava, cotton, maize, sorghum, swetpotato Ghana- cotton, cowpea, rice Egypt cotton, potato, wheat, cucumber, melon Uganda - banana, cotton, cassava, maize, rice Nigeria - cowpea, cassava, sorghum

32 Institutions with capacity to conduct GM research in Tanzania Mikocheni Agric Research Utafiti ndani ya maabara Institute (MARI) (contained research) University of DSM (UDSM)

33 Genetic engineering- Steps Contained research in labs and glass houses Contained facility at MARI

34 Contained research at MARI Modern lab facility at Mikocheni Contained research on cassava mosaic disease and cassava brown streak disease CBSD from /12/

35 Confined field trials Tanzania has no confined field trials WEMA project has applied for permit for drought tolerant maize 11/12/

36 CFT site Makutopora Dodoma Govt in collaboration K, Ug, Moz, na SA are implementing a Water Efficient Maize for Africa (WEMA) Trial site of about (2ha) at Makutupora, Dodoma Not planted But 1 st CFT is expected this year

47 Challenges for Biotech R&D in TZ Inadequate funding for R&D Limited awareness on biotech Lack of critical mass of highly trained scientists, technicians & entrepreneurs Activists!!!!!
